Transaction 3626107fca69bdd8ba0e81d42dd54119a65bf3302f4f90bc0128757cb8d0642f
1 Input
1 Output
-
3626107fca69bdd8ba0e81d42dd54119a65bf3302f4f90bc0128757cb8d0642f:0
- value
- 896418
- script pubkey
- OP_0 OP_PUSHBYTES_20 c586a3e2ee76cc833e9cac30274a30f87cc08c7f
- address
- bc1qckr28chwwmxgx05u4sczwj3slp7vprrl492d5e